5. Why did they go to other
countries?
REASONS:
1)
2)
3)
4)
5)
6)
Cyclical crises in the Basque agriculture.
Emigrants who had been installed across the Atlantic
called to other people of Basque country to go there.
The Carlist Wars also led to the emigration.
The introduction of compulsory military service in the
armies of France and Spain drove many men to
emigration.
Population pressure.
The traditional lifestyle had broken when the
industrialitation came but many basques prefer the
traditional lifestyle so they went to farmer sites.
